Lion’s Gate Reminder

Lion’s Gate Reminder

The “Lion’s Gate” occurs each year, and its portal tends to open on July 25th (or about this date), and the 25th is “The Day Out of Time”.

The star system “Sirius” (“Sepdet” in ancient times) rises over the pyramids on the Giza Plateau.

Some say it begins when our Sun moves into the sign of Leo a few days earlier than the 25th.

The date of “August 8th” is used by many people who follow Pythagorean Numerology because of August being the eighth month and, of course, the eighth day occurs.

So, it is often also referred to as the “8/8 Portal”.

Metaphysically, on its side, the number “8” is the symbol for “Infinity” and also for the Master Number”11″ with a number”1″ being placed in each of the circles.

In ancient times, the rising of “Sirius” signaled the opportunity for spiritual and material abundance, and the “Nile” River (known originally as “Hapi”) overflowed.

Water has always represented a spiritual message and the teaching that “The Spirit Moves on the Face of the Waters”.

>From the time that our Sun enters Leo to the time that it enters Virgo is technically the “Lion’s Gate” (Tropical Zodiac) —an entire month of special sacred attunements.
